LAB Tokenizes Real-World Assets, Gaining Traction Among Investors
LAB is a decentralized blockchain protocol designed to tokenize and trade real-world assets like art, real estate, and commodities. Built on Ethereum, it enables fractional ownership and liquidity for traditionally illiquid markets.
The protocol operates as a layer-2 solution that leverages smart contracts to mint, trade, and settle tokenized asset transactions. Each LAB token represents a fraction of an underlying real-world asset, verified through third-party auditors and stored on-chain via immutable metadata.
LAB has gained traction among institutional and retail investors in 2026, with a market cap exceeding $500 million. Its use cases extend to several sectors, including real estate tokenization, fine art and collectibles, commodities and precious metals, and supply chain finance.
